
Contact us
About company
From print to post-processing, integrate an end-to-end solution that allows your business to operate more efficiently and profitably. Click to learn more.
US
Unknown
Not verified company
From print to post-processing, integrate an end-to-end solution that allows your business to operate more efficiently and profitably. Click to learn more.